COATED CUTTING TOOL |
摘要 |
The present invention relates to a coated cutting tool comprising a substrate and a multilayered (Ti,Al)N coating. The coating comprises three zones: a first zone (A) closest to the substrate, a second zone (B) adjacent to the first zone and a third outermost zone (C). All three zones each comprises a multilayered aperiodic structure of (Ti,Al)N, where the average composition for each zone is different from each other and where the ratio between the thickness of the zone C and zone B is between 1.3 and 2.2 and where zzone C>Zzone B, where z is the average composition for each zone of the ratio z=Ti/AI. The coating has a low residual stress. |

主权项 |
1. A coated cutting tool comprising:
a substrates and a multilayered (Ti,Al)N coating, wherein the coating includes three zones: a first zone (A) closest to the substrate, a second zone (B) adjacent to the first zone and a third outermost zone (C) the second and third zones B and C each having a multilayered aperiodic structure of alternating individual (Ti,Al)N layers X and Y, wherein individual layer X has a composition with a higher Ti-content than individual layer Y, the average composition for each zone being different from each other and a ratio between the thickness of zone C and zone B is between 1.3 and 2.2 and where zzone C>Zzone B, where z is the average composition for each zone of the ratio z=Ti/Al. |
